Analysis

In 2018, uis: percentage of population age 25+ whose highest level of in Republic of Moldova stood at 22.1%.

That represents a change of up 1.9% on the previous year and up 20.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, uis: percentage of population age 25+ whose highest level of in Republic of Moldova peaked at 58.9% in 1989 and was at its lowest, 18.1%, in 2009.

Republic of Moldova ranks 17th of 90 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 11 years of available data.

The percentage of population (age 25 and over) with completed lower secondary education (ISCED 2) as the highest level of educational attainment. This indicator is calculated by dividing the number of persons aged 25 years and above who completed lower secondary education as the highest level of educational attainment by the total population of the same age group and multiplying the result by 100. The UNESCO Institute for Statistics (UIS) educational attainment dataset shows the educational composition of the population aged 25 years and above and hence the stock and quality of human capital within a country. The dataset also reflects the structure and performance of the education system and its accumulated impact on human capital formation.
